@Jololi, the installer uses the registry to try and find the correct location to install R into. If you can, I'd uninstall and reinstall R, installing both the 32-bit and 64-bit versions at the same time. Best I know, there isn't an R 3.3.2.2 release, so that's probably just an error that crept in during a previous install. If you know that the version in 3.3.2.2 is correct and what you'd like to use, alternatively you could set the R_HOME variable to point at the location of the R installation directory you'd like to use.
